Original IPA Circa 1840 (for Sacagawea)

IPA as it tasted when it was still shipped to India. Brewed with 100% English pale malt and 160 IBUs of East Kent Goldings hops. Aged in oak barrels with Brettanomyces for a full year then dry hopped with more EKG.

Label Information:
IPA as it tasted when it was still shipped to India. Brewed with 100% English pale malt and 160 IBUs of East Kent Goldings hops. Aged in oak barrels with Brettanomyces for a full year then dry hopped with more EKG.
OG 1.065
FG 1.013
IBU 160
Picked up a late 2024 500 ml bottle from the Zebulon tap room on 2-8-25 for $12.00. Cold stored since purchase.
Beer poured deep gold with a nice white head.
Nose is funk forward and grassy, earthy, with a touch of citrus.
Taste is a lighter malt base that immediately yields to the Brett which imparts of funky barnyard flavor into the brew. Hopping brings a nice grass and lemon flavor. Finishes pretty bitter as this leaves citrus zest coating the back of my palate; 8/10 on my bitterness scale.
Mouthfeel is light to medium bodied and is very refreshing.
Overall, what a delightful beer to have, another gem from the highly regarded historical brewer Mike Karnowski!
